Ingredients
  

  • 1 ½ pounds ground beef
  • 1 pc. egg
  • ½ cup breadcrumbs
  • 1 pc. onion minced
  • 1 ½ tsp. lemon juice
  • ½ cup chili sauce
  • 1 cup cranberry sauce

Instructions
 

  • Set your oven to 350°F degrees and line a baking sheet.
  • Combine the beef, breadcrumbs, onion, and egg in a bowl.
  • Mix until combined. We recommend using your hands.
  • Work the meat into bite-sized balls.
  • Place the meatballs on your baking sheet.
  • Bake for 30 minutes.
  • In the meantime, combine the lemon juice, chili sauce, and cranberry sauce in a slow cooker.
  • Transfer the meatballs, and toss to coat.
  • Set the heat to low until heated through, then steam throughout the night.

Notes

  • The meat — While our Schweddy balls recipe makes the best of your ground beef, it’s important not to overwork the meat. Work it gently, using your hands, and don’t overdo it. Otherwise, the meatballs will be prone to falling apart.
 
  • The ground beef — For the best version of our Schweddy balls recipe, you’d want to get your ground beef lean. Keep in mind that the 80/20 ratio is the ideal.
